Address

Rprtuz4sZKXxyNL8winDQ9fnWg6MR44qpC

0 RDD

Confirmed
Total Received29117.50763826 RDD8.68 CNY
Total Sent29117.50763826 RDD8.68 CNY
Final Balance0 RDD0.00 CNY
No. Transactions2

Transactions

Rprtuz4sZKXxyNL8winDQ9fnWg6MR44qpC29117.50763826 RDD3.25 CNY8.68 CNY
 
Rt7YxuBzwba5GNL9dJBHLBCx1xKe6umehM28747.93150156 RDD3.21 CNY8.57 CNY
Rt43mUfwTWTtbAGKXqKHr6HUMiUky3g4ej369.57613670 RDD0.04 CNY0.11 CNY×
Rv4zUr1Ut5CpshXr7tgBS5XeePvCHZXeLt49625.79833901 RDD5.54 CNY14.80 CNY
 
Rprtuz4sZKXxyNL8winDQ9fnWg6MR44qpC29117.50763826 RDD3.25 CNY8.68 CNY
RaXE2xKYDMgHhp1yFK8bd7gbB7QzZaMx6p20508.29070075 RDD2.29 CNY6.12 CNY